The Cursed Throne of Eternity
In the heart of the ancient kingdom of Aeloria, the throne of Eternity had been a symbol of power and unity for centuries. The throne was said to be enchanted, imbued with the essence of the first king, who had united the warring tribes under one banner. However, whispers of a curse had long since begun to spread among the people, a curse that brought misfortune and death to anyone who dared to sit upon it.
The current king, Rolen, was a man of immense strength and wisdom, but he was haunted by the throne's curse. His predecessor, his own father, had met a mysterious fate after sitting upon the throne, and Rolen feared that he might suffer the same fate. Determined to uncover the truth, he embarked on a journey that would take him through the darkest corners of his kingdom and into the heart of an ancient mystery.
As Rolen ventured into the forbidden chambers beneath the castle, he was accompanied by his most trusted advisor, Elara, and his loyal knight, Thorne. The trio navigated through a labyrinth of corridors, each step echoing with the echoes of the past. Elara, a sorceress of great skill, felt the pull of the throne's magic, a force that seemed to call out to her with an ancient, haunting voice.
"Elara," Rolen whispered, his voice barely above a whisper, "what do you feel?"
"I sense a power, a presence," she replied, her eyes narrowing. "It's not just the throne—it's something much older, something that predates even the throne itself."
The trio reached the heart of the throne room, where the throne stood, its surface covered in intricate carvings that seemed to shift and change as if alive. Rolen approached the throne, his heart pounding with a mix of fear and curiosity.
"Rolen, no," Elara's voice cut through the silence. "You must not sit upon it."
But it was too late. Rolen felt the magic of the throne envelop him, and as he sat down, the carvings on the throne began to glow with an eerie light. The room seemed to spin around him, and he was thrown into a vision of his father's final moments.
In the vision, Rolen saw his father surrounded by his closest advisors, each of them holding a dark, twisted artifact. The advisors were plotting to overthrow the king, but they were unaware that their leader was the one who had cursed the throne. As Rolen's father confronted his betrayers, the throne began to hum with a dangerous energy, and his father's life force was drained away.
Rolen awoke from the vision, his breath coming in ragged gasps. "It was them," he whispered. "They cursed the throne to ensure no one could ever dethrone them."
Elara stepped forward, her eyes gleaming with determination. "But why? What do they gain from this?"
Rolen's gaze turned to Thorne, who had been silent until now. "Because," Thorne began, "they are not who they claim to be. They are descendants of the ancient kings who were overthrown by your father. They seek to restore their lineage at any cost."
The revelation sent shockwaves through Rolen. He had been deceived by those he trusted most. The advisors who had sworn loyalty were actually plotting his downfall.
"Then we must stop them," Elara declared. "The throne of Eternity must be freed from its curse, and the truth must be revealed."
The trio set out on a mission to expose the traitors and break the curse. They faced numerous challenges, including a sorcerer who had sworn allegiance to the traitors, and a maze of political intrigue that threatened to consume them. Along the way, they discovered that the throne's magic was not just a curse but a source of immense power, a power that could be harnessed to restore balance to the kingdom.
In the climactic battle, Rolen, Elara, and Thorne confronted the traitors in the throne room, the magic of the throne swirling around them. Elara cast a spell to free the throne of its curse, and the room was bathed in a blinding light. When the light faded, the throne stood before them, its surface now smooth and uncarved, a symbol of purity and truth.
The traitors were defeated, and the truth was revealed to the kingdom. Rolen's reign was marked by a new era of unity and prosperity, as he and Elara worked together to rebuild the kingdom and restore its former glory.
As the years passed, Rolen often sat upon the throne, not as a king bound by curse, but as a leader whose rule was guided by wisdom and compassion. The throne of Eternity had been freed, and the kingdom of Aeloria flourished under the leadership of its enduring king.
